
html, body {
    height: 100%;
    margin: 0;
    padding: 0;
    background-color:cadetblue;
  }
  

/*----------------------font styles--------------*/
body {
     font-family: Arial, Helvetica, sans-serif;
     color:black;
 }
 p {
     font-size: 16px;
     text-align: left;
     width: 500px;
 }
  
a {
    text-decoration: none;
    font-size: 18px;
    color: white;
}

h1 {
    font-size: 20px;
    font-weight: bold;
}

h2 {
    font-size: 18px;
    margin: 0;
    padding: 0;
}

h3 {
    font-size: 16px;
}

h4 {
    font-size: 16px;
    font-weight: normal;
    font-style: italic;
}


#desktop {
    margin:0;
    width: 15%;
    background-color:cadetblue;
    position: fixed;
    height: 100%;
    top: 0;
    }

#desktop li a {
  text-decoration: none;
  color: white;
  font-size: 16px;
  text-align: left;
}

#desktop li {
    list-style-type: none;
    padding-top: 25px;
}

#desktop li a:hover {
   color: black;
}


#desktop ul {
    padding: 10px;
}

main {
    position: relative;
    margin-left: 15%;
    margin-top: 5;
    /* height:100%; */
    background-color:#D5E1DF;
}

#start {
   height: 70%; 
   }
   


#start button {
    background-color: cadetblue;
    color: white;
    border:none;
    border-radius: 4px;
    line-height: 20px;
    font-size: 14px;
    padding:10px;
}
#start figure {
    padding: 10;
    margin: 10;
    padding-bottom:2%;
}
#start img {
    box-shadow: 4px 6px 10px;
}

.starttext {
    width: 500px;
}

/*-------------über mich ---------------------------------*/

#ubermich {
   /* height: 100%; */
   display: grid;
   grid-template-columns: 1fr 1fr;
  }
#ubermich div {
    margin:20px;
    padding:30px;
}
#img {
    /* width: 60%; */
    box-shadow: 4px 6px 10px;
    margin-bottom: 20px;
    margin-top: 0;
}

/*--------------Coaching Privat----------------------------*/

#coachingprivat {
    height: 100%;
    display: grid;
    grid-template-columns: 1fr 1fr;
   }

#coachingprivat div {
    height: 84%;
    margin:12px;
    padding:12px;
}

 /*--------------Coaching beruflich----------------------------*/

 #coachingberuflich {
    height: 100%;
    display: grid;
    grid-template-columns: 1fr 1fr;
 }

 #coachingberuflich div {
    height: 84%;
    margin:12px;
    padding:12px;    
 }

 /*--------------Coaching Team----------------------------*/

 #coachingteam {
    height: 100%;
    display: grid;
    grid-template-columns: 1fr 1fr;
   }

 #coachingteam div {
    height: 84%;
     margin:15px;
     padding:15px;
 }

 #coachingteam ul {
     width: 500px;
 }

 /*--------------Konflikt----------------------------*/

 #konflikt {
    height: 100%;
    display: grid;
    grid-template-columns: 1fr 1fr;
 }

 #konflikt div {
    height: 84%;
    margin:20px;
    padding:30px;
 }
 
 #konflikt h4 {
     width: 500px;
 }

/*--------------Mediation----------------------------*/

 #mediation {
    height: 100%;
    display: grid;
    grid-template-columns: 1fr 1fr;
   }

 #mediation div {
    /* height: 84%; */
    margin:20px;
    padding:30px;
 }

 #mediation ul {
    width: 500px;
 }

 /*--------------Moderation----------------------------*/

 #moderation {
    height: 100%;
    display: grid;
    grid-template-columns: 1fr 1fr;
   }

 #moderation div {
    /* height: 84%; */
    margin:20px;
    padding:30px;
 }

 
/*--------------datenschutz--------------------------*/

 #datenschutz {
    display: grid;
    grid-template-columns: 1fr 1fr;
 }

 #datenschutz div {
    margin-left: 20px;
    padding:10px;
 }
 
 #datenschutz li {
     width:500px;
 }

/*--------------Impressum----------------------------*/

#impressum {
    position: relative;
    margin-left: 15%;
    margin-top: 5;
    background-color:#D5E1DF;
}

#impressum table {
    margin-left:150px;
}

